Congress Addresses Merger Rumors with TMC
The Congress party has firmly rejected rumors regarding a potential merger with the Trinamool Congress (TMC), labeling such reports as unfounded speculation. During a press conference, Congress General Secretary K.C. Venugopal stated that discussions held recently with former West Bengal Chief Minister Mamata Banerjee and her nephew Abhishek Banerjee were strictly focused on national issues, with no conversations about a merger between the two parties. He emphasized that these are baseless rumors. The meeting between TMC and Congress leaders aimed solely at discussing how to effectively raise national issues.

Speculation about a possible merger between TMC and Congress gained traction after Mamata Banerjee and Abhishek Banerjee attended a meeting of the INDIA bloc in New Delhi on Monday. During this gathering, both leaders also met with Congress Parliamentary Party Chairperson Sonia Gandhi and Opposition Leader Rahul Gandhi. This fueled rumors that TMC might merge with Congress nearly three decades after separating from the party. These speculations arose amidst differences within TMC's legislative and parliamentary factions. This development comes just a month after TMC lost power in West Bengal, where it secured only 80 seats in the 294-member assembly. However, TMC has not officially commented on the possibility of a merger. TMC MP Sougata Roy, considered close to Mamata Banerjee, stated that it is essential for the party to collaborate with Congress, but he also noted that it remains to be seen whether this cooperation will take the form of an alliance or a merger.
